ARCOPLATE product range from Alloy Steel International
Arco Alloy 1600 Arco Alloy 1600 is recommended for moderate impact and high abrasion applications
Arco Alloy 800 Arco Alloy 800 is recommended for moderate to high abrasion and low to moderate impact applications
Arco Alloy 810 Arco Alloy 810 is recommended for moderate to high abrasion and moderate to high impact applications
Arco Alloy 1040 Arco Alloy 1040 is recommended for moderate impact, high abrasion and cyclic temperatures up to 500°C. Applications include steel mill roll guide shoes, clinker feeders, coke feeders and in Iron Ore pellet plants
Arco Alloy 1080 Arco Alloy 1080 is recommended for moderate to high impact and suitable for higher cyclic temperatures up to 700°C
Arco Alloy 8668 Arco Alloy 8668 is recommended for very high abrasion, moderate impact and suitable for high continuos temperatures to 700°C
Arco Alloy 2100 Arco Alloy 2100 is recommended for very high abrasion and low impact applications. Suitable for applications where the use of ceramics may be to risky to apply or where hang up may present severe problems in ore flow

Cement Mixer Breaks all Records |
22 March, 2002 |
Alloy Steel International (ASI) received a call from Blokpave which is a division of the BGC group of companies. Blokpave are a diversified construction group manufacturing a broad range of building and construction materials. Blokpave purchased their mixers from a manufacturer in Germany. The original wear liners were alloy castings, heat treated to give a hardness of 60 RoC. Even though these castings were hard by castings standards their life expectancy caught BGC by surprise. After six months of continuous service BGC were caught out when the protective liners became worn out and BGC were not prepared for such rapid wear.
Hence they were caught without any spare liners for their cement mixers.
ASI received a call from Mr Stephan Bunting Superintendent of Maintenance asking ASI whether or not Arcoplate was able to help him out of a situation where replacement liners had a lead time of 4 months from the OEM. The original mixer has now been running continuous for two years and subsequently BGC have upgraded their other two mixers to Arcoplate 2565 6 on 5.
Besides the mixer walls being lined with Arcoplate 2565 6 on 5 Mr Bunting has also upgraded the mixer paddles with Arcoplate 10 on 9 2560. Since that time BGC Blokpave have gradually introduced Arcoplate in all areas where wear was a problem which caused considerable down-time and lost productivity.
